Hanging basket displays have long been the favourite choice for many pubs and we love nothing better than sitting in a lovely pub garden surrounded by trailing plants and flowers from these baskets. But looking after baskets is time consuming, especially with the amount of watering and feeding needed to keep them looking their best. But by simply installing an automatic watering system (which you can buy from any DIY store or garden centre), you can get rid of your watering can and simply have your plants watered at the most convenient time for you and your customers. Bamboos and other architectural plants have become more popular in recent years and often a pub garden will feature a few of these jungle-like plants in their garden as natural barriers or privacy screens. (Have a look at Deco Pots website – they do a fantastic range of what they call live barriers for outdoor smoking areas). Dense plants like bamboo always look even more spectacular at night with the right lighting such as up lighters and spot lights. LED lights for the outdoors are also popular and can be strung around plants such as topiary rosemary bushes and buxus.
An alternative to live planting is replica plants – these products have come a long way in recent years and nowadays it’s often difficult to tell them apart from the real thing! Replica hanging baskets and plants also mean you can enjoy year round colour without the hassle of looking after the plants yourselves.
